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 25 and 35 is 175
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 175 - For the 1st fraction, since 25 × 7 = 175,
50/25 = 50 × 7/25 × 7 = 350/175 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 35 × 5 = 175,
21/35 = 21 × 5/35 × 5 = 105/175 - Add the two like fractions:
350/175 + 105/175 = 350 + 105/175 = 455/175 - 455/175 simplified gives 13/5
- So, 50/25 + 21/35 = 13/5
